Healthy grass-fed whey protein

To help repair and build muscle Specially formulated with two dynamic forms of whey protein (isolate and concentrate), arguably the best protein for supporting and promoting muscle tissue. Research shows that whey protein helps increase lean body mass, strength and muscle size, and helps repair and build muscle tissue when used in combination with strength training. Healthy Grass-Fed Whey Protein comes from dairy cows that have 100% grass-fed diet. This product provides an excellent profile of amino acids, representing the next generation in natural protein supplementation.
